BTS has starred in hundreds of episodes of their own variety programs. Archives keep track of master lists, external viewing links, and subtitles for: Run BTS! (Their long-running, chaotic variety show) Bon Voyage (Multi-season travel reality series) In the SOOP (A healing, nature-focused reality show)

Perhaps the most crucial element in globalizing the archive is the work of countless , such as BTS-Trans and Bangtan Subs . These volunteer-based groups take all the content from Korean-language platforms—from interviews and live streams to the members' own Weverse posts and lyrics—and provide near real-time translations in dozens of languages. Without them, the archive would be inaccessible to the vast majority of the global ARMY.
